Ingredients:

  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ream, whipped to stiff peaks
  • 1 package (3.4 oz) instant banana pudding mix
  • 2 cups cold milk
  • 8 waffle cones
  • ½ cup crushed vanilla wafers or grabeef beef ham crackers
  • Caramel sauce or sweetened condensed milk drizzle
  • Extra crushed vanilla wafers
  • Crafting the Creamy Banana Cheesecake Filling

    This is where the magic begin extracts! We’ll be creating a luscious filling that combines the tang of cream cheese with the irresistible flavor of banana pudding.

  • Whip Up the Creamy Base: In a medium mixing bowl, beat together the soft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until the mixture is perfectly smooth and creamy. You want to ensure there are absolutely no lumps of cream cheese remaining. A hand mixer or a stand mixer will make this process quick and effortless. If you don’t have a mixer, a sturdy whisk and some elbow grease will do the trick! Once smooth, gently fold in the whipped heavy cream. Be careful not to overmix at this stage; we want to keep that lovely airy texture from the whipped cream. This folding technique incorporates the whipped cream without deflating it, resulting in a lighter, more delightful cheesecake filling.
  • Prepare the Banana Pudding: In a separate bowl, whisk together the instant banana pudding mix and the cold milk. Whisk vigorously for about two minutes, or until the pudding begin extracts to thicken. Instant pudding is wonderfully convenient, but it’s important to follow the package directions closely for the best texture. Allow the pudding to set for about 5 minutes to ensure it reaches its full, creamy consistency. This waiting period is crucial for the pudding to firm up, otherwise, it might make our cheesecake filling too runny.
  • Combine the Flavors: Now, it’s time to bring our two delicious components together! Gently fold the thickened banana pudding into the cream cheese mixture. Continue to fold until everything is just combined and you have a beautifully smooth, uniformly colored banana cheesecake filling. Take your time with this step. Overmixing can sometimes make the filling a bit heavy, so a gentle fold is key to achieving that light and airy texture we’re aiming for. The aroma at this stage is already incredible, hinting at the deliciousness to come!
  • Assembling the Cones

    This is the fun, hands-on part! We get to transform simple waffle cones into edible masterpieces.

  • Get Your Cones Ready: Grab your waffle cones. If you find your cones are a little delicate, you can lightly press the bottom edge onto a flat surface to give them a stable base, making them easier to fill and handle. We’re going to fill these beauties generously with our banana cheesecake mixture. Using a spoon or a piping bag (if you’re feeling fancy and want perfectly swirled cones), fill each waffle cone almost to the very top with the banana cheesecake pudding. Don’t be shy – pack them full! The goal is to have a delightful dome of filling peeking out of the top.
  • The Irresistible Crum extractb Coating: This is where we add that classic banana pudding element and a satisfying crunch! Sprinkle the crushed vanilla wafers (or grabeef beef ham crackers, if you’re feeling adventurous and want a salty-sweet twist!) generously over the top of the banana cheesecake filling in each cone. You want to create a delightful layer of crum extractbs that will adhere to the creamy filling. If you don’t have crushed wafers, you can also use grabeef ham cracker crum extractbs. Press them down gently so they stick well.
  • The Finishing Touches: For the grand finnon-alcoholic ale, drizzle your favorite caramel sauce or sweetened condensed milk over the top of each cone. This adds an extra layer of sweetness and visual appeal. Finally, sprinkle a few extra crushed vanilla wafers over the drizzle for that perfect finishing touch. These cones are best enjoyed immediately, allowing you to experience the full delightful contrast of the crisp cone, creamy filling, and crunchy crum extractbs. However, if you need to make them a little ahead of time, you can refrigerate them for up to an hour, but be aware that the cones might soften slightly.

    Frequently Asked Questions:

    Can I make the cheesecake filling ahead of time?

    Absolutely! The cheesecake filling can be made up to 2 days in advance and st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ator. This can save you a lot of time on the day you plan to assemble the cones.

    What kind of cones work best for this recipe?

    Waffle cones are ideal because their sturdy structure and slightly sweet flavor complement the cheesecake and banana beautifully. Sugar cones can also work, but they might be a bit more delicate. Avoid cake cones, as they are too soft.

    How should I store any leftover Banana Pudding Cheesecake Cones?

    Leftovers are best st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They will stay fresh for about 2-3 days. Be aware that the cone might soften slightly over time, but they’ll still be incredibly tasty!

    Ingredients

    •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
    • ½ cup powdered sugar
    • ½ tsp vanilla extract
    • 1 cup heavy whipping cream, whipped to stiff peaks
    • 1 package (3.4 oz) instant banana pudding mix
    • 2 cups cold milk
    • 8 waffle cones
    • ½ cup crushed vanilla wafers
    • Caramel sauce drizzle
    • Extra crushed vanilla wafers for garnish

    Instructions

    1. Step 1
      In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Gradually beat in the powdered sugar until well combined.
    2. Step 2
      Stir in the vanilla extract. Gently fold in the whipped heavy cream until the mixture is smooth and creamy.
    3. Step 3
      In a separate medium bowl, whisk together the instant banana pudding mix and cold milk. Let it sit for 5 minutes to thicken.
    4. Step 4
      Gently fold the thickened banana pudding into the cream cheese mixture. Be careful not to overmix.
    5. Step 5
      Spoon a layer of the banana pudding cheesecake mixture into each waffle cone. Sprinkle with crushed vanilla wafers.
    6. Step 6
      Repeat the layering process until the cones are full. Drizzle with caramel sauce or sweetened condensed milk.
    7. Step 7
      Garnish with extra crushed vanilla wafers. Chill for at least 15 minutes before serving.
